Sepia

CC-276 | benjamin-moore | HEX: #DBBE99 | RGB: 219, 190, 153

Benjamin Moore Sepia CC-276: A Timeless and Versatile Neutral

Benjamin Moore Sepia CC-276 is a warm, earthy neutral that exudes understated elegance and timeless sophistication. This inviting shade is part of Benjamin Moore's Classic Color Collection, known for its enduring appeal and versatility. Sepia CC-276 is a rich, medium-toned brown with subtle undertones, making it a perfect choice for those seeking a grounded and organic aesthetic in their space.


Undertones of Sepia CC-276

What makes Sepia CC-276 stand out is its unique undertone composition. This color has a distinct warmth with reddish-brown and taupe undertones that create a cozy and welcoming atmosphere. Unlike cooler browns, Sepia leans toward the warmer end of the spectrum, giving it a rich, almost velvety depth. The red undertones add a hint of drama, while the taupe notes keep it well-balanced and versatile. These undertones make it an excellent choice for both traditional and modern interiors, offering a sophisticated backdrop without feeling overpowering.


Coordinating Colors for a Cohesive Palette

Benjamin Moore Sepia CC-276 pairs beautifully with a variety of other colors, making it an excellent foundation for building a cohesive color scheme. Here are some coordinating colors to consider:

  1. Neutral Pairings:

    • Benjamin Moore Simply White (OC-117): A clean, crisp white that adds contrast and highlights the warmth of Sepia.
    • Benjamin Moore Revere Pewter (HC-172): A soft gray that complements Sepia’s earthy tones while adding a subtle modern touch.
  2. Accent Colors:

    • Benjamin Moore Moroccan Spice (AF-285): A bold, spicy red that enhances the reddish undertones in Sepia.
    • Benjamin Moore Dijon (193): A deep golden yellow that adds warmth and vibrancy to the palette.
  3. Cool Contrasts:

    • Benjamin Moore Stratton Blue (HC-142): A muted blue-green that provides a striking yet harmonious contrast.
    • Benjamin Moore Arctic Gray (1577): A pale gray-blue that gently offsets Sepia’s warmth for a balanced look.

By incorporating these coordinating colors, you can create a layered and dynamic design that feels polished and intentional.


Ideal Uses for Benjamin Moore Sepia CC-276

Sepia CC-276 is a versatile shade that works beautifully across a wide range of design applications. Its warm, earthy nature makes it suitable for both intimate spaces and larger areas where a sense of coziness is desired. Here are some ideas to inspire you:

  • Living Rooms: Sepia CC-276 creates a warm and inviting atmosphere, perfect for living rooms where family and friends gather. Pair it with soft cream furnishings and metallic accents for a modern yet comfortable look.

  • Dining Rooms: The rich, grounded quality of this color makes it an excellent choice for dining rooms. It enhances the ambiance and provides a sophisticated backdrop for shared meals and special occasions.

  • Bedrooms: In bedrooms, Sepia brings a sense of calm and relaxation. Pair it with plush textiles, such as velvet or linen, and warm lighting to create a luxurious retreat.

  • Kitchens: For a chic and contemporary kitchen, consider using Sepia CC-276 on cabinetry or as an accent wall. Pair it with white quartz countertops and a subway tile backsplash for a timeless aesthetic.

  • Home Offices: Sepia’s grounding qualities make it ideal for a home office, where focus and productivity are key. Pair it with wood tones and natural textures to create a workspace that feels both professional and approachable.

  • Exteriors: Sepia CC-276 isn’t just for interiors—it’s also a stunning choice for exteriors. Its earthy tones blend beautifully with natural surroundings, making it a great option for siding, trim, or even a front door.
